They start sprouting within a day or 2! Put seeds on a wet paper towel, put in a ziploc, and put in a warm place. Voila! I then transplant them into a small pot of soil. Why It’s Easy: Peas (Pisum sativum) germinate in 7-10 days and grow fast, even in containers. Soaking seeds speeds things up—they’re ready to sprout when they sink (floaters are duds).
What seeds can grow in 3 weeks?
Radishes are one of the fastest vegetables you can grow from seed. Many varieties are ready to harvest in about 3 to 4 weeks after planting. Lettuce and baby greens are also quick growers and can often be harvested in about 30 days. Quick-growing vegetables for cool spring and fall gardens include leafy greens, carrots, beets, radishes, and peas. Many are ready from seed to harvest just four to six weeks.
